The primary purpose of community solar is to allow members of a community the opportunity to share the benefits of solar power. Participants get a reduced Xcel electric bill by owning the electricity generated by the community solar garden, which costs less than the price they would ordinarily pay to Xcel.
We are creating an innovative model for equitable, accessible community solar gardens funded by neighborhoods that bring benefits to the neighborhood and garden subscribers, regardless of whether you rent or own, with no money down, and regardless of income or credit score. True COMMUNITY solar!
